About the Role
The Company is in search of a Head of Human Resources to play a pivotal role in the strategic development and management of all HR functions. The successful candidate will be a key partner to the executive team, ensuring that HR strategies align with the organization's mission and support its long-term growth. This leadership position is not focused on recruitment but rather on employee relations, performance management, policy creation, and fostering a strong organizational culture. The Head of HR will be responsible for leading a team, maintaining compliance with employment laws, and enhancing the workplace environment through various initiatives. A deep understanding of HR best practices, particularly in multi-site and highly regulated environments, is essential.
Applicants for the Head of Human Resources role at the company should have a Bachelor's degree (Master's preferred) and at least 10 years' of progressive HR experience, with a minimum of 5 years' in a senior or executive capacity. Experience in healthcare, behavioral health, or a similar regulated human services setting is strongly preferred. The role requires a candidate with a proven track record in strategic HR management, strong interpersonal and leadership skills, and the ability to influence and collaborate across diverse teams. High emotional intelligence, discretion, and a commitment to diversity, equity, and inclusion are also key qualifications. The Head of HR will be expected to maintain strong relationships with external partners and ensure continuous compliance, as well as manage a growing HR team and develop data-driven reporting to support the organization's HR metrics.
